Coverage and Publication Identity
The foreword identifies this as the Infiniti/Nissan factory service manual for the 2005 FX35 and FX45, Model S50 Series. The model table lists FX35 2WD code TLJALTN-EUA, FX35 AWD codes TLJNLTN-EUA/ENA, and FX45 AWD codes TPHNLTN-EUA/ENA; the EUA and ENA applications are assigned to the USA and Canada respectively. This is a whole-vehicle service set rather than a transmission-and-cruise extract.
Its indexed sections span powertrain, chassis, body, climate, restraint, communications, convenience, and electrical systems. That breadth matters when a repair crosses module boundaries, such as an ICC fault accompanied by CAN communication codes or an AWD complaint involving the transmission, transfer, ABS/VDC, and network sections.
Component and System Documentation
The engine material is divided between VQ35DE and VK45DE procedures. It reaches beyond routine maintenance into timing-chain and camshaft work, cylinder-head removal and overhaul, valve-guide, valve-seat, and valve-clearance service, engine assembly removal, and cylinder-block disassembly, measurement, bearing selection, and assembly. VQ35DE engine removal is separated for 2WD and AWD packaging. Engine Control adds OBD-II DTC workflows, CONSULT-II and GST functions, ECM connector layouts and reference data, wiring diagrams, sensor graphs, fuel-pressure testing, EVAP/ORVR and PCV diagnosis, VIN registration, accelerator-pedal and throttle-position learning, and idle-air-volume learning.
The RE5R05A chapter covers ATF level and replacement checks, cooler cleaning and flushing, shift-system and interlock service, TCM input/output diagnosis, solenoid and circuit testing, line-pressure and road-test procedures, and fault diagnosis with or without CONSULT-II. Repair depth extends through 2WD/AWD transmission removal, torque-converter and oil-pump inspection, clutch-pack and triple-planetary disassembly, valve-body teardown, internal end-play and clearance adjustment, and final assembly. Cross-sectional views, the clutch-and-band application chart, gear-by-gear power-flow diagrams, oil-channel drawings, and shim, bearing, washer, and snap-ring location views support the overhaul sections.
AWD coverage follows the drivetrain through the ETX13B electronically controlled transfer, CAN-linked AWD control, fail-safe diagnosis, transfer removal and overhaul, the F160A front final drive, and the R200 rear final drive. The differential chapters address tooth contact, backlash, preload, pinion height, runout, shim selection, seals, and assembly. Propeller shafts, wheel hubs, drive shafts, steering gear and pump, suspension members, struts, shocks, links, stabilizers, and wheel alignment have dedicated repair sections.
Brake documentation spans fluid and bleeding work, hydraulic piping, master cylinder and booster service, caliper overhaul, rotor inspection, and parking-brake adjustment. Brake Control adds VDC, TCS, ABS, and EBD diagrams and diagnostics, steering-angle-sensor neutral adjustment, and AWD deceleration-G-sensor calibration. TPMS coverage includes transmitter ID registration with or without the J-45295 activation tool.
Specification Highlights and Technical Data
The service sections supply component-specific torque tables, fluid and lubricant specifications, capacities, pressure-test data, electrical values, connector pinouts, wear limits, clearances, end play, preload, alignment data, and calibration specifications. The transmission fluid notes identify the required Matic J application and warn that unsuitable substitutes can affect shift performance and durability.
Electrical diagnosis is organized around 10 CAN system types, selected according to engine, 2WD/AWD layout, navigation, ICC, Intelligent Key, lane-departure warning, and automatic-drive-positioner equipment. Configuration tables, CONSULT-II CAN support-monitor procedures, check sheets, and circuit-isolation schematics link the ECM, TCM, AWD unit, ICC unit, BCM, combination meter, ABS actuator, seat control unit, display, and IPDM E/R. The VK45DE material also retains a serial split for the P1148/P1168 closed-loop confirmation procedure: up to serial 400595 except 400590, versus serial 400590 and serial 400596 onward.
Representative visual references include the VQ35DE/VK45DE ECM circuit and connector layouts, RE5R05A 2WD/AWD cross-sections and clutch chart, the ETX13B power-transfer diagram, the VDC/TCS/ABS hydraulic circuit, CAN Type 1–10 schematics, and the ICC target-board and laser-beam aiming layout. Other sections cover Intelligent Key registration, NATS/IVIS diagnosis, xenon headlamp aiming, R-134a climate-control testing, base and Bose audio, navigation self-diagnosis, rear entertainment, SRS fault tracing, body-alignment measurements, and high-strength-steel panel repair information.
ICC, Driver Assistance, and Repair Cautions
The cruise-control material covers conventional ASCD operation and Intelligent Cruise Control, including vehicle-to-vehicle distance control, conventional fixed-speed mode, and brake-assist-with-preview functions. It provides action and running tests, system schematics, ICC unit and laser-sensor terminal data, CONSULT-II work support, self-diagnosis, data monitor and active tests, DTC and symptom workflows, component removal, and laser aiming with target board KV99110100 (J-45718). Separate Driver Information procedures address LDW camera aiming and rear-view monitor guideline correction after relevant component work.
Several factory cautions show why the detailed repair sequence matters. After timing-chain removal, the crankshaft and camshafts must not be rotated independently because valve-to-piston contact can result. The rear final drive uses a collapsible pinion spacer; exceeding the specified preload calls for spacer replacement rather than backing off the pinion nut, which can leave the bearing and gear setup incorrect. During RE5R05A valve-body repair, lint-free materials are required because ordinary shop-rag fibers can interfere with precision valve operation.
